Kenya now goes hi-tech in breeding food crops Thursday March 11 2021 Summary Kenya has turned to digital platform in breeding of crops after years of relying on traditional equipment, coming as a boost to local researchers who can now conduct and trace the research process digitally. The platform will make it easier for local research organisations to undertake digital breeding of food crops such as maize, wheat, rice and sorghum enabling them to store the records and digitally process for use by the future generations. FARMKENYA INITIATIVE News By Robert Amalemba | February 20th 2021 at 12:00:00 GMT +0300 Have you come across a cockerel weighing a cool 2.5 kilogrammes? Very rare. Well, this was one of the many attractions showcased during the just-ended 2021 Annual Mkulima Expo at the Kenya Agricultural and Livestock Research Organisation (Kalro) centre in Kakamega. And probably because Kakamega is stereotyped as the home of chicken lovers, the stand showcasing the giant bird was packed with curious farmers who wanted to know the secret behind the bird s admirable weight. Experts at the stand explained that the four-month-old rooster is a Kalro improved Kienyeji variety (KC). The weight, they said, is as a result of embracing recommended best practices from egg selection for hatching, to brooding, to vaccination, to proper feeding. ....
